Overview of the Anatomy Science Olympiad Event

The anatomy science olympiad is an academic competition event where students are tested on their knowledge of human anatomy and physiological systems. Typically held at regional, state, and national levels, this event requires participants to identify anatomical structures, explain functions of different body systems, and solve related problems. The competition is designed to challenge students’ memorization, comprehension, and application skills in anatomy science.

Format and Structure

The event usually consists of a written test combined with practical identification tasks. Students may be asked to label diagrams, answer multiple-choice questions, or identify anatomical models or images. The exam covers various topics including the skeletal, muscular, cardiovascular, nervous, and digestive systems. Time limits and scoring criteria vary by competition level, but accuracy and depth of knowledge are always critical factors.

Eligibility and Team Composition

Participants in the anatomy science olympiad are generally middle school and high school students who are part of a Science Olympiad team. Teams can consist of several members, but individual performance is often emphasized in this event. Coaches and educators usually guide students in their preparation, helping them understand complex concepts and improve their test-taking skills.

Key Topics Covered in the Anatomy Science Olympiad

The content of the anatomy science olympiad spans the major systems of the human body. A thorough grasp of these systems and their interrelations is essential for success. The event emphasizes not only memorization but also the functional understanding of anatomy.

Skeletal System

This topic includes the identification of major bones, bone classification, and understanding bone functions. Students need to recognize bone landmarks and comprehend the role of the skeletal system in support, movement, and protection.

Muscular System

Participants study muscle types, major muscle groups, and their functions. Questions may require identification of muscles on diagrams, understanding muscle mechanics, and the role of muscles in voluntary and involuntary movements.

Nervous System

The nervous system section covers the structure and function of the brain, spinal cord, and peripheral nerves. Students should be familiar with neuron anatomy, neural pathways, and the integration of sensory and motor functions.

Cardiovascular System

This includes the anatomy of the heart, blood vessels, and the flow of blood throughout the body. Understanding cardiac cycles, blood components, and circulatory pathways is critical.

Digestive and Other Systems

The digestive system topic involves the study of organs responsible for food breakdown and nutrient absorption. Additional body systems such as respiratory, endocrine, and urinary systems are often included to provide a comprehensive picture of human anatomy.

Preparation Strategies for Competitors

Effective preparation for the anatomy science olympiad combines memorization, conceptual understanding, and practical application. Students must adopt systematic study methods to master the extensive content.

Study Techniques

Active learning techniques such as flashcards, labeling exercises, and 3D models significantly enhance retention. Group study sessions allow competitors to quiz each other and clarify complex topics. Regular practice with past tests or sample questions familiarizes students with the format and timing.

Utilizing Visual Aids

Visual aids like anatomical charts, interactive software, and physical models play a crucial role in understanding spatial relationships within the body. Visualizing structures helps students recall details more effectively during competition.

Time Management

Establishing a study schedule that allocates sufficient time for each body system ensures balanced preparation. Competitors should also practice under timed conditions to improve their speed and accuracy during the event.

Frequently Asked Questions

What are the main topics covered in the Anatomy event of the Science Olympiad?
The Anatomy event in Science Olympiad typically covers human body systems, organ identification, physiological functions, and anatomical terminology.
How can students effectively prepare for the Anatomy Science Olympiad event?
Students can prepare by studying detailed anatomy textbooks, using 3D anatomy apps, practicing with diagrams and models, and reviewing past Science Olympiad questions.
What types of questions are commonly asked in the Anatomy event at Science Olympiad competitions?
Questions often include multiple-choice, labeling diagrams, identifying organs or systems, matching functions to structures, and short answer questions on physiological processes.
Are there any recommended resources or textbooks for studying anatomy for Science Olympiad?
Recommended resources include 'Gray's Anatomy for Students,' 'Netter's Atlas of Human Anatomy,' Khan Academy Anatomy videos, and Science Olympiad official study guides.
How is the Anatomy event scored in Science Olympiad competitions?
The Anatomy event is scored based on the accuracy and completeness of answers to written tests, practical identification tasks, and sometimes lab-based activities, with points awarded for each correct response.
